Online & Distance Learning at Point Loma Nazarene University
Distance learning is available at Point Loma Nazarene University. Among 4,757 students, 1,243 (26%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 961 (20%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for Health Professions Graduates from Point Loma Nazarene University
Graduates of Point Loma Nazarene University’s Health Professions program earn the following amounts (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):
| Years After Graduation | Median Earnings |
|---|---|
| 1 year | $65,881 |
| 2 years | $70,901 |
| 3 years | $109,241 |
| 4 years | $94,961 |
| 5 years | $101,708 |
Is this above or below average for the school? At the four-year mark, Health Professions graduates from Point Loma Nazarene University earn a median of $94,961, compared with $72,728 for all Point Loma Nazarene University graduates — about 31% higher than the school-wide median.
Median Debt at Graduation
The median debt for Health Professions graduates from Point Loma Nazarene University is $26,681.
